Smart Features: Transforming Laundry into a Seamless Experience

The integration of smart technology into washing machines and dryers has revolutionized the way we approach laundry. These appliances now come equipped with Wi-Fi connectivity, allowing users to control and monitor their laundry cycles remotely. Imagine starting your wash while still at work or receiving notifications when a cycle is complete. This connectivity enhances convenience and ensures that laundry fits seamlessly into our busy schedules.

Smart features extend beyond remote control. Many modern machines offer advanced diagnostics, alerting users to potential issues before they become significant problems. This proactive approach not only saves time but also reduces maintenance costs. Additionally, some models include voice control compatibility, enabling users to operate their machines through voice commands, further simplifying the laundry process.

Energy Efficiency: A Step Towards Sustainability

Environmental consciousness is a crucial consideration in today’s world, and advanced washing machines and dryers are designed with this in mind. Energy efficiency is a key feature, with many models boasting Energy Star certification. These machines use less water and electricity, reducing the overall environmental impact and lowering utility bills.

Incorporating features such as load sensing technology, these appliances adjust water and energy usage based on the size of the load, ensuring optimal performance without waste. Additionally, some dryers utilize heat pump technology, which recycles heat during the drying process, further enhancing energy efficiency. These advancements not only contribute to a greener planet but also offer significant cost savings for consumers.

Innovative Washing and Drying Technologies

Today’s washing machines and dryers are equipped with a range of innovative technologies that enhance their performance. For instance, steam technology is becoming increasingly popular in washing machines. It penetrates fabrics more efficiently, removing stubborn stains and allergens without the need for harsh chemicals. This feature is particularly beneficial for households with sensitive skin or allergies.

Dryers have also seen remarkable advancements, with some models offering moisture sensors that detect when clothes are dry and automatically adjust the cycle to prevent over-drying. This not only protects fabrics but also saves energy. Furthermore, the introduction of reverse tumbling technology in dryers ensures even drying and reduces wrinkles, making ironing a breeze.
